Krivoy Rog (Miocene of Ukraine)
Also known as Kryvyi Rih
Where: Dnipropetrovsk, Ukraine (47.9° N, 33.4° E: paleocoordinates 48.2° N, 32.7° E)
• coordinate estimated from map
When: Late/Upper Miocene (11.6 - 5.3 Ma)
• JA: nominally early Miocene, but definitely late Miocene based on occurrence of Hipparion
Environment/lithology: terrestrial; lithology not reported
Size classes: macrofossils, mesofossils
Primary reference: E. I. Belyaeva. 1948. Catalogue of Tertiary Fossil Sites of the Land Mammals in the U.S.S.R. [M. Uhen/M. Uhen]more details
Purpose of describing collection: general faunal/floral analysis
